现在的位置: 首页 > 综合 > 正文

MYSQL免安装的配置和修改密码

2013年10月26日 ⁄ 综合 ⁄ 共 1416字 ⁄ 字号 评论关闭

 客户服务器用的是windows server2003,偶在安装数据库的时候遇到了问题。网上说的是不要下载msi的。只能下载手动安装的。然后本人亲自下载了6.0.9、6.0.10、11、7.0.9、7.20等多个版本,当然优先考虑6.0这几个,但是没有安装成功。最后下载了免安装包mysql-noinstall-6.0.9-alpha-win32.zip,网上查看攻略。亲自走了遍。特此记录。

        1.下载 MySQL 6.0免安装版

        http://dev.mysql.com/get/Downloads/MySQL-6.0/mysql-noinstall-6.0.9-alpha-win32.zip/from/pick#mirrors

        2.将 MySQL6.0 解压到待安装目录(自己决定放到哪)。解压后默认文件夹名称为:mysql-6.0.9-alpha-win32(当然可以自己更改),然后在环境变量中设置MYSQL_HOME(这样,以后可以用%MYSQL_HOME%引用安装目录)。如,我放在E盘根目录下,所以,MYSQL_HOME设置为:E:\mysql-6.0.9-alpha-win32

         3.打开文件my-huge.ini另存为my.ini,在my.ini文件最后(当然也可以在其他地方)加入如下配置。(my.ini记得是保存在与my-huge.ini同一个目录下的)(#表示注释)

[mysqld]

 # 设置mysql的安装目录

basedir=E:\mysql-6.0.9-alpha-win32

# 设置mysql数据库的数据的存放目录,必须是data,或者是[url=file://\\xxx-data]\\xxx-data[/url]

datadir=E:\mysql-6.0.9-alpha-win32\data

        4.把%MYSQL_HOME%\bin 加入到 path环境变量中。

        5.在命令行(cmd)执行命令:mysqld -install  。将mysql安装为windows服务。(一定注意,执行此命令时一定要在安装目录下的\bin目录下执行。否则会出问题。)

        6.执行命令: net start mysql 或在windows管理工具->服务里找到MySQL服务,启动。

        7.在命令行中运行 mysql -uroot  (可在任意目录下,因为前面设置了path变量)。即可进入数据库。这样操作后,mysql安装完成。

然后进入修改密码的过程。实际操作如下:

  1.关闭正在运行的MySQL。

  2.打开DOS窗口,转到mysql\bin目录。

  3.输入mysqld --skip-grant-tables回车。如果没有出现提示信息,那就对了。

  4.再开一个DOS窗口(因为刚才那个DOS窗口已经不能动了),转到mysql\bin目录。

  5.输入mysql回车,如果成功,将出现MySQL提示符 >

  6. 连接权限数据库>use mysql; (>是本来就有的提示符,别忘了最后的分号)

  7.改密码:> update user set password=password("123456") where user="root"; 

  8.刷新权限(必须的步骤)>flush privileges;

  9.退出 > \q

  10.注销系统,再进入,开MySQL,使用用户名root和刚才设置的新密码123456登陆。

抱歉!评论已关闭.